Subtract 30/20 from 21/5

1st number: 4 1/5, 2nd number: 1 10/20

21/5 - 30/20 is 27/10.

Steps for subtracting f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 5 and 20 is 20

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 20
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 5 × 4 = 20,
    21/5 = 21 × 4/5 × 4 = 84/20
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 20 × 1 = 20,
    30/20 = 30 × 1/20 × 1 = 30/20
  4. Subtract the two like fractions:
    84/20 - 30/20 = 84 - 30/20 = 54/20
  5. After reducing the fraction, the answer is 27/10
  6. In mixed form: 27/10
